`
zjut_xiongfeng
  • 浏览: 287301 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
社区版块
存档分类
最新评论

同屏幕显示多个 ALV

 
阅读更多

CALL FUNCTION 'REUSE_ALV_BLOCK_LIST_INIT'
EXPORTING
i_callback_program = sy-repid.


CALL FUNCTION 'REUSE_ALV_BLOCK_LIST_APPEND'
EXPORTING
it_fieldcat = field_catalog[]
is_layout = layout
i_tabname = 'ITAB'
it_events = events[]
TABLES
t_outtab = itab[].

CALL FUNCTION 'REUSE_ALV_BLOCK_LIST_APPEND'
EXPORTING
it_fieldcat = field_catalog[]
is_layout = layout
i_tabname = 'ITAB'
it_events = events[]
TABLES
t_outtab = itab[].

CALL FUNCTION 'REUSE_ALV_BLOCK_LIST_APPEND'
EXPORTING
it_fieldcat = field_catalog[]
is_layout = layout
i_tabname = 'ITAB'
it_events = events[]
TABLES
t_outtab = itab[].

最后再

CALLFUNCTION'REUSE_ALV_BLOCK_LIST_DISPLAY'
就可以了。

分享到:
评论

相关推荐

    ABAP OOALV

    - **输出**:ALV的输出不同于传统ALV的调用方式,而是通过屏幕0100进行显示。首先需要创建一个编号为0100的屏幕,并在其中设置CustomerControl,名称为`GC_CON`。 - ```abap CALL SCREEN 0100. ``` - **刷新**...

    ABAP OOALV学习文档

    **ALV GRID CONTROL (ALV 网格控制器)** 是实现精美屏幕显示的关键组件,它利用控制器技术并通过系统的全局类方法响应各种操作事件。 ##### 控制结构概述 - **字段目录 (Field Catalog)**:用于控制 ALV 显示的...

    SAP 标准屏幕ALV增强

    在SAP系统中,ALV(Accelerated List Viewer)是一种常用的数据展示工具,它提供了标准的表格形式来显示数据。然而,有时业务需求可能需要对这些标准屏幕进行定制或增强,以满足特定的报告和展示需求。本篇将详细...

    ALV导出数据到EXCEL时数据丢失位数的解决方法

    * 解决这个问题的关键在于解决条件2和条件3,具体来说,就是在做ALV Fieldcat的时候,需要指定参考表和参考字段,并且确保列的表头文本比实际显示的数据长。 * 在调用REUSE_ALV_GRID_DISPLAY函数时,需要将gd_...

    sap alv 去掉多余按钮

    具体到代码片段中的操作,可以看出开发者正在动态地向`RT_EXTAB`中添加了多个功能代码,包括`&EB9`、`&VEXCEL`、`&AQW`、`%SL`、`&ABC`、`&INFO`以及`&RNT_PREV`。每个功能代码都代表了ALV界面中的一个按钮,例如`&...

    sap alv简单案例

    在本例中,首先定义了一个工作区`wa_alv`,该工作区包含了多个字段,如`cheid`(产品检验ID)、`batno`(批号)、`werks`(工厂)、`chcer`(检验员)、`ctime`(检验时间)、`matnr`(物料号)、`checkitemcode`(检验项目代码)...

    SAP OO ALV技术介绍.pptx

    1. 需要画一个屏幕,在屏幕上画一个容器(即ALV所显示的位置、大小),创建相应的容器类cl_gui_custom_container,基于容器的实例创建ALV实例。 2. 需要自定义的事件类,并完成相应的事件响应代码。 3. 功能码响应...

    SAP ABAP ALV 详解

    在调用 ALV 的函数时,需要确认这两个参数的输入,例如 REUSE_ALV_LIST_DISPLAY 函数用于输出 LIST 型列表,REUSE_ALV_POPUP_TO_SELECT 函数用于在弹出的对话框中显示 LIST 列表;REUSE_ALV_GRID_DISPLAY 函数用于...

    ALV_GRID介绍

    ALV GRID CONTROL采用控制器技术,通过屏幕显示实现美观的效果。如同其他控制器一样,ALV GRID CONTROL通过系统中的全局类提供方法以响应其动作。使用ABAP对象后,列表可以通过ALV的一个实例(INSTANCE)来显示,...

    ALV & SMARTFORMS 并分页

    屏幕内建ALV通过内建的函数模块直接调用,而编程控制ALV则允许开发者通过源码定制更多的功能。在处理大量数据时,分页是必不可少的,可以有效提高系统性能和用户体验。在ALV中实现分页,可以通过设置RFC调用来限制...

    sap的alv开发应用

    通过类型池,可以一次性定义多个数据元素,减少代码量并提高可读性。例如: ```abap TYPE-POOLS: SLIS. ``` 这里声明了一个类型池`SLIS`,用于后续定义数据结构时使用。 ### 2. 声明结构 结构定义了包含多个字段的...

    abap alv 总结

    ALV 格式的数据是以单元格为单位显示,SAP 提供了一套 ALV 的功能模块,可以对输出报表的样式作修饰,提高报表输出的可读性和功能性。 二、开发 ALV 的基本流程 开发 ALV 的基本流程主要包括:选择屏幕上字段、...

    sap ALV常用参数的详细描述

    7. **it_events**:此参数允许定义多个事件处理器,用于处理不同的事件,例如表头的显示设置等。 8. **i_grid_settings**:此参数用于设置表格的打印表头等特性。 9. **it_sort**:此参数定义了数据的排序方式。 ...

    在ALV里编写回车事件

    其中,ALV(Application List Viewer)是SAP ABAP平台上一个强大的列表显示工具,它允许开发者创建高度自定义的列表,支持多种列类型、排序、筛选等功能。在ALV中,编写回车事件是一项常见需求,尤其是在需要响应...

    WDA ALV程序创建显示自己做的记录步骤

    WDA ALV程序创建显示自己做的记录步骤需要通过多个步骤来实现,包括创建WDA程序,添加ALV组件,实现方法WDDOINIT,实现SELECT_OPTIONS组件,初始化选择屏幕,隐藏自带按钮,创建Range Table,添加Range Table到...

    abap alv字段介绍

    此函数接收多个参数,包括字段类别(`it_fieldcat`)、排序信息(`it_sort`)、布局(`is_layout`)以及事件回调(`i_callback_pf_status_set`, `i_callback_user_command`)。通过这些参数的合理配置,可以实现复杂的数据...

    SAP ALV报表开发指南.pdf

    REUSE_ALV_GRID_DISPLAY函数是一个常用的函数,用于显示GRID风格的报表。该函数需要传入相关的参数,例如报表的标题、报表的数据、报表的格式等。开发者可以根据需要,自定义报表的样式和内容。 REUSE_ALV_...

    源代码(ALV 报表 F4 增删插改按钮功能).pdf

    ALV报表F4按钮功能的实现涉及到多个SAP ABAP编程对象和功能,主要包括: 1. ALV Grid 控件:ALV Grid是SAP ABAP环境中用于显示数据的交互式列表控件,它支持对显示数据的格式化和个性化配置。ALV Grid控件能够为...

    ABAP--ALV

    有时候,我们可能需要在一个ALV中同时展示多个内部表的信息。这可以通过在程序中定义多个内部表并将它们合并到一个统一的视图中来实现。 #### 六、ALV中的交互报表程序 (Interactive Reporting in ALV) 交互报表...

    ALV上加自己定义的按钮

    在开始之前,确保已经创建了一个ALV的基本结构,包括数据源和初始显示逻辑。 #### 2. 定义自定义按钮 要定义一个自定义按钮,首先需要在程序中设置PF-Status。PF-Status是SAP用来管理屏幕上的按钮和菜单项的一种...

Global site tag (gtag.js) - Google Analytics